gpt4 book ai didi

java - Android Native初学者: Where can I find more about these types of syntax (java interface,继承等)

转载 作者:行者123 更新时间:2023-12-02 10:56:49 24 4
gpt4 key购买 nike

我已经了解了基本的java语法,但是我刚刚在android文档中看到了一些新的东西,而我的谷歌技能并没有太大帮助。

https://developer.android.com/guide/topics/ui/layout/listview

class ListViewLoader : ListActivity(), LoaderManager.LoaderCallbacks<Cursor> 
{

// This is the Adapter being used to display the list's data
private lateinit var mAdapter: SimpleCursorAdapter

//...
val root: ViewGroup = findViewById(android.R.id.content)
// ...

这种不使用extendsimplement的类声明的名称是什么?

还有这些 var 声明类型的名称。

在哪里可以找到这是 Android 特定的还是所有 Java 风格的?

最佳答案

您问题中的代码不是用 Java 编写的。它是用 Kotlin 编写的,Kotlin 是 Android 开发人员可以使用的另一种编程语言。

您引用的项目是 Kotlin 语法。该语法并非 Android 开发所独有,但也不是 Java 语法。

在该页面上,您可以看到示例代码,您将在该代码上方看到两个选项卡,标记为“KOTLIN”和“JAVA”。您可以在两种语言之间切换示例。

关于java - Android Native初学者: Where can I find more about these types of syntax (java interface,继承等),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51663711/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com